Object Detection

A set of sensors to detect obstacles is essential for robots. They can't climb up tight corners or stairs, so they need to be able to spot obstacles. They can help them avoid crashing into objects and falling over them. Some robots are equipped with cliff sensors, which bounce infrared light off the walls and floor to measure the distance of a drop. If the robot is too close to a ledge or a steep threshold it will back away and return to its original position.

More advanced robots also use other sensors to recognize objects like furniture legs or wall edges, allowing them to navigate around them with greater precision. They can also vacuum up dirt that has accumulated on the edges of furniture or a room.

Mapping

It is essential that your robot vacuum cleaner understands where it is going to avoid hitting objects or falling down stairs. That's why mapping technology in robot vacuum cleaners is such a valuable piece of engineering.

The majority of basic robot vacuums will simply start cleaning when they're turned on, but more advanced models may track the room or the entire home prior to starting to clean. It is common to view the map in an app that is accompanied by it, and use it to guide your robot more easily.

To create this map The robot will usually bounce infrared light off of the floor and use that to determine how close it is to the floor itself. This allows it to detect obstacles such as walls, furniture or a sunken space. It will then alter direction or reverse in order to avoid hitting them.

The cliff sensors on the more advanced robots are designed to detect sudden changes in the distance between the robot's base and floor. This could mean that it's close to the edge of a staircase for instance, and will back up to keep from falling over.

However, it's still impossible for robots to "see" the steps or ledge from its own perspective. To make it easier for robots to avoid shoes, toys and cords, obstacle-avoidance functions are now standard on all robots.

The majority of robots allow you to create your own exclusion zone by drawing virtual boundaries onto the accompanying application. You can then indicate the areas you don't want the robot to move. It's a great option for those who have a messy house and aren't confident in their robot to avoid things by itself. But, be aware that this kind of mapping consumes an enormous amount of power, which can result in a shorter runtime for the robot and potentially lower performance overall.

Battery Life

Robots are far more sophisticated than vacuum cleaners. However, they do require a battery. Like any battery, the robot's battery will decrease over time. The life span of a robot could be extended by taking good care. This includes charging the robot fully before each use and wiping it down with dry towels to avoid corrosion. It also helps to avoid exposure to extreme temperatures, and using less often can decrease wear-and-tear.

The battery life of different models is different. Some models can clean a whole home with just one charge, whereas other models are only able to clean a small apartment or a room. It's also important to think about whether the device comes with an charging dock or requires manually plugging in between cleaning tasks, since this can impact the time it takes to charge between runs.

Connectivity

A robot vacuum will eliminate a lot of the tedium that comes with cleaning floors, and a growing number of models are incorporating mopping capabilities. Many models can be controlled via apps for smartphones, or via voice commands using smart speakers. Some models will also allow you to create virtual barriers that they will be able to avoid. This is great for homes that have lots of areas to keep off limits like kids' playpens or dog beds.

These machines operate independently on a set of wheels, and scoop dirt into their suction zones, or into a small, filtered dustbin. They can also be programmed to clean according to a set schedule or to return to charging stations when they're done.

Robots come with a range of sensors that help them discover and navigate their surroundings. They can use lasers to scan furniture and walls, or cliff sensors to alert them when they come close to stairs or sunken rooms. Obstacle avoidance systems may also be crucial, but they're not foolproof. We've seen robots get hung up on shoes and socks or even get themselves caught in curtains with tassels.

When it comes to maintenance it is necessary to check the side and brush for hairs that are tangled from time to time, empty and rinse the dust bin (if appropriate) after each cleaning session, and wipe down any cameras or sensors between sessions.
